Russia's Islamic threat Gordon M. Hahn

By: Hahn, Gordon MMaterial type: TextTextPublication details: New Haven [a. o.] Yale University Press 2007Description: XIV, 349 p., 2 l. mapsISBN: 030012077X; 9780300120776Subject(s): Terrorism -- Russia (Federation) | Muslims -- Russia (Federation) | Terrorism -- Religious aspects -- Islam | терроризм | мусульмане | джихадизм | Дагестан | Северный Кавказ | Кабардино-Балкария | Татарстан | ислам | исламизм | Российская Федерация | национализмDDC classification: 363.3250947 LOC classification: HV6433.R9 | H34 2007Other classification: Ф3(2)63 Online resources: Table of contents only | Contributor biographical information | Publisher description
Contents:
Russia's Muslim and Islamist challenge -- The Chechan quagmire and its consequences -- Russia's jihadist network -- The rise of jihadism in Dagestan -- The rise of jihadism in Kabardino-Balkariya and the Western North Caucasus -- Tatarstan and the Tatars : nationalism, Islam, and islamism -- Conclusions and security implications -- Appendix: chronology of terrorism in Dagestan, 2002-2005.
